Born 1972, in South Korea; Ethnicity: "Korean." Education: Amherst College, B.A., 1994; Vermont College, M.F.A., 2000.
Agent—c/o Author Mail, Front Street Books, 20 Battery Park Ave., Asheville, NC 28801.
Writer. Taught English and history at the middle school level.
A Step from Heaven (young adult novel), Front Street Books (Asheville, NC), 2001.
A Step from Heaven was adapted as an audiobook by Listening Library, 2002.
